mean_operator

Mean operator

class tasrif.processing_pipeline.pandas.mean_operator.MeanOperator(**kwargs)

Mean operator

Examples

>>> import pandas as pd
>>> from tasrif.processing_pipeline.pandas import MeanOperator
>>> df = pd.DataFrame([
...     [1, 1, 3],
...     [1, 1, 5],
...     [1, 2, 3],
...     [2, 1, 10],
...     [2, 1, 0]],
...     columns=['logId', 'sleep_level', 'awake_count'])
>>>
>>> df = df.set_index('logId')
>>> op = MeanOperator()
>>> df1 = op.process(df)
>>> df1[0]
sleep_level    1.2
awake_count    4.2
dtype: int64
__init__(**kwargs)

Creates a new instance of MeanOperator

Parameters

kwargs – Arguments to pandas pd.mean function